I used ZocDoc to seach for a back doctor using my insurance which is Cigna Open Access Plus. It stated that Dr. Paul M. Brisson, MD was in my network so I booked an appointment with him 1 week in advance, on Monday, October 29th, 2018.' I arrive today at the office and tell the Office Person my name. She confirmed with her computer that I have an appointment. She then tells me that Dr. Brinsson was not in Cigna Open Access Plus Network and my fee would be $540.00 to for the office visit. She also adds that he is never in the office on Mondays. I asked: So why would accept the appointment Zocdoc if he is not in the office? Why does Zocdoc state you Dr. Brinsson is in Cigna Open Access Plus Network if you are not? Dr. Brinson requires you to upload your insurance card on ZocDoc to make an appointment. Why was I not called to be told he does not accept my insurance after I uploaded my insurance card into Dr. Brinsson's ZOCDOC accounts. Why would your office not call me to let me know he is not in the office on Monday and not to make the trip?!?!?!?! Why would you not call me to let me know he does not take my insurance and he is not in the office? I was in the system, no one knew to call me and tell me not to come, or at the very least, reschedule? What terrible service by ZocDoc and the Doctor's Incompetent staff. I cannot say if the Doctor is good or bad, but his staff is bad.
